UHD 620 vs GeForce 940MX benchmarks
According to the hardwareDB Benchmark, the GeForce 940MX GPU is faster than the UHD 620 in gaming.
The GeForce 940MX has a significantly higher core clock speed. This is the frequency at which the graphics core is running at. While not necessarily an indicator of overall performance, this metric can be useful when comparing two GPUs based on the same architecture. In addition, the GeForce 940MX also has a slightly higher boost clock speed. The boost clock speed is the frequency that the GPU core can reach if the temperature is low enough. The allows for higher performance in certain scenarios.
In addition, the UHD 620 has a significantly lower TDP at 15 W when compared to the GeForce 940MX at 23 W. This is not a measure of performance, but rather the amount of heat generated by the chip when running at its highest speed.
According to the results of the hardwareDB benchmark utility, the GeForce 940MX is faster than the UHD 620.
